Application Software Engineer

SpaceX

Quick summary

Work type
On-site
Location
Starbase, TX
Posted
4 days ago

Market check

Salary context

How this pay compares to similar roles

Similar $152k
$109k most similar roles pay here $196k

This listing doesn't post a salary. Most similar roles pay $122,500–$181,725.

Based on 240 similar postings.

Employer

About SpaceX

SpaceX designs, manufactures, and launches advanced rockets and spacecraft with the mission of enabling humans to become a multi-planetary species. It operates the Falcon 9, Falcon Heavy, and Starship launch vehicles, as well as the Starlink satellite internet constellation.

SpaceX currently has 656 open roles on FindRole.

Listed pay typically runs $130,000–$160,000 across 482 roles with salary data.

Most-posted roles

View all roles at SpaceX

At a glance

TL;DR · Application Software Engineer

Join Starbase, TX as a Senior Software Engineer on the cutting-edge product development team. You will lead the design and implementation of scalable backend services using modern cloud technologies, focusing on enhancing user experience through efficient data management and API integration. Key responsibilities include building robust, secure, and high-performance systems, collaborating with cross-functional teams to deliver innovative solutions, and adhering to ITAR compliance standards for defense-related projects. Proficiency in Java, Python, or Go, along with extensive knowledge of AWS services and Kubernetes, is essential. Experience with microservices architecture and CI/CD pipelines will be highly valued as you tackle complex challenges in a dynamic environment.

What you'll do

  • Develop and maintain software applications for mission-critical systems.
  • Ensure compliance with ITAR regulations in all project activities.
  • Design and implement secure data storage solutions.
  • Conduct code reviews to ensure quality and security standards are met.
  • Troubleshoot and resolve complex technical issues efficiently.

What we're looking for

  • Must have 5+ years of relevant IT experience.
  • Strong background in software development and system integration required.
  • Proficiency in multiple programming languages such as Java, Python, or C++.
  • Experience with cloud platforms like AWS, Azure, or Google Cloud is essential.
  • Possess excellent problem-solving skills and the ability to work under pressure.

More like this

Similar roles

Software Engineer

Applied Materials

Santa Clara, CA 70 days ago $179,500$246,500
C# Python C++ EtherCAT motion control safety logic configuration software architecture API design communication protocols device synchronization recipe handling error and safety signaling data transfer system status monitoring logging cross-functional collaboration semiconductor equipment control robotics optical imaging systems FPGA programming

Software Engineer

Genworth Financial

Richmond, Virginia 3 days ago $96,700$145,000
Python Flask JavaScript HTML CSS React Angular Vue Azure App Service GitLab CI/CD DevSecOps Azure PostgreSQL Azure Kubernetes Docker Terraform Prometheus Grafana Swagger/OpenAPI JSON/WebAPI
Hybrid

Software Engineer

Applied Materials

Santa Clara, CA 38 days ago $152,000$209,000
Python C++ Java Rust PyTorch FPGA Modern C++ Machine learning Web service architecture Signal processing Computer vision Robotics User interface design Mathematical modelling Numerical methods GPU programming Embedded system development

Software Engineer

Robinhood

Menlo Park, CA 30 days ago $161,637$195,000
Go Python Kubernetes Docker Terraform EC2 S3 IAM VPC CloudFormation Prometheus Grafana Buildkite Jenkins GitHub Actions PostgreSQL Redis DynamoDB CI/CD
Hybrid

Software Engineer

Robinhood

Menlo Park, CA 30 days ago $135,699$150,000
Swift Kotlin Apple SDKs Android SDKs Mobile UI frameworks RESTful APIs Version control systems Unit testing frameworks
Hybrid

Software Engineer

Robinhood

Menlo Park, CA 30 days ago $161,637$195,000
Java Kotlin GoLang Python Scala PostgreSQL MySQL Redis DynamoDB RESTful APIs Distributed systems Logging and monitoring tools Automated testing frameworks
Hybrid